This is the switch screwed into the drivers (right hand) side of the gearbox top housing and is the switch closer to the rear of the gearbox. It is a critical electronic sensor that communicates the selected gear position (Park, Reverse, Neutral, Drive, etc.) to the vehicle's Engine Control Unit (ECU). A replacement is often required due to electrical failure caused by age, wear, or contamination from moisture and dirt.
A faulty neutral position switch can prevent your vehicle from starting, as its primary safety function is to only allow the engine to crank when in Park or Neutral. If left unresolved, you could be left stranded with a vehicle that will not start, or worse, create a dangerous situation where the vehicle could potentially start in gear and lurch forward or backward unexpectedly.
Not to be mistaken with the reverse switch- which is located in front of this switch and has a different plug.
Installation is a straightforward job for a workshop or experienced DIY mechanic, though access to the top of the gearbox is the main consideration. While no other parts are typically required, it is wise to inspect the condition of the electrical connector and wiring for any damage or corrosion during installation.
